    In 2016, the EU decided to support the programme “Civil society and media”. It will be implemented on two separate and yet interrelated components dealing with the Civil Society Sector and the Media Sector respectively. The overall objective of the programme is to strengthen democracy in Jordan through increased participation of citizens in political life and through increased independence, quality, and credibility of the media and Civil Society Organisations (CSOs).

    The present assignment is related to the component 1 “Support to Civil society” and its objective is to assist the National Centre for Human Rights technically in best practices on CSO engagement and outreach and in the practical aspects of EU project management and financial procedures with regards to all activities to be implemented during the project’s period, including supporting the Centre to launch one or several calls for proposals for CSOs/CBOs.

    Type of services provided

    • Supporting vulnerable CSOs with easier access to funding and on-going capacity building;
    • Supporting the NCHR in the development of outreach and engagement tools with civil society;
    • Organizations and specifically with Community Based Organizations in all governorates of Jordan;
    • Preparation of the Programme Estimates;
    • Preparation and launching of calls for proposals (guidelines, evaluation committees, selection process, etc.);
    • Day to day management of the civil society mechanism (administrative preparatory tasks related to planning activities, procurement, grants and financial management, etc.);
    • Monitoring of project implementation;
    • Reporting preparation;
    • Communication and visibility, dialogue with other related programmes.
